French winemaker Julien explains the intricacies of French wine pronunciation, detailing how to pronounce the name of famous regional wine appellation from Bourgogne that allows to blend Gamay with Pinot Noir grapes to make fruity affordable Budguny wines (also sometimes a little Chardonnay, Pinot Gris and Pinot Blanc), a wine name that translates into ‘pass the grapes’ from French.
